Sebestopol, VIC - Holy Trinity Anglican
Address: 227 Albert Street, , Sebestopol Victoria, 3356
On 16th September 1867 Archdeacon Stretch laid the foundation stone of the front portion of the Church. It measured 30ft x 36ft, and was designed by Mr HR Caselli at an estimated cost of £600 (it would eventually cost 877/1/3). The Chancel end was closed in with wood to allow for future extensions and the Church was opened for worship by…

Selby, VIC - All Saints Anglican
Year Built: 1938
Address: Lacy Street, , Selby Victoria, 3159
The land and the church were given to the people of Selby by Mr. Allen Tye in memory of his wife, Carlotta. The Church was erected in 1938 of local stone by Allen Charles Tye and his daughter in memory Carlotta Louise Tye.

In 1855 a grant of land was given by the Government. It was situated at the northern end of Emily Street, but it was found to be unsatisfactory because it was too far from the town and was subject to flooding. This grant was later cancelled and in 1869 another grant was made of the present site. Patrick Hanna who donated the church bell…

Shepparton, VIC - Scot's Uniting
Year Built: 1885
Address: Corner Corio & fryers Streets, , Shepparton Victoria, 3630
Formerly a Presbyterian the Church was formed in 1885. However a Reverend Thomson conducted services in the area from 1876. In 1885 a parcel of land was donated by Mr William Fraser and by May 1886 tenders were let to fence the land. By December of the same year it was decided to call tenders to build a church. The Church was partly…

Year Built: 1892
Address: Carngham Linton Road, , Snake Valley Victoria, 3351
Formerly a Presbyterian Church it was built in 1892-93 and was wholly endowed as a memorial to the squatter The Hon Philip Russell (1822-1892). It cost more than £10,00 to build, a phenomenal sum at the time. The architect was J.J. Jackson, of Beaufort, and D. Brown the builder; the designed was modelled upon that of The Scot's Church,…
Soldiers Hill, VIC - Scots Presbyterian
Year Built: 1890
Address: 415 Lydiard Street N, Ballarat, Soldiers Hill Victoria, 3350
Built in 1890 to a Gothic-inspired design by local architects Figgis & Molloy. The foundation stone of Scots Church was laid on 5 July 1890 by Sir James MacBain, Scottish-born businessman and president of the Victorian Legislative Council. The church is on a rectangular plan without transepts. The nave is of six bays, buttressed…

Sorrento, VIC - St John's Anglican
Year Built: 1874
Address: Point Nepean Road, , Sorrento Victoria, 3943
St John's Church of England, Nepean Highway, Sorrento, was commenced in 1874, the transepts being added in 1889 and the chancel during 1908-11. The small limestone Church is conventionally planned with an apsidal east end. Walls are of random coursed masonry with rendered parapet, buttress cappings and plinth (probably later) and a slate…
South Geelong, VIC - Uniting
Year Built: 1842
Address: Corner Moorabool & Balliang Streets, , South Geelong Victoria, 3220
The first Methodist services in South Geelong were held in 1842 in a private home, and by 1847 had been transferred to a large unclaimed house. In 1854, the first dedicated building was constructed as a church/school at a cost of £1,475. The foundation stone of the brick building was laid on the 14!h June 1854 by the Rev. William Butters.…
